Understanding the Restrictions on Battery Energy Storage
In recent years, battery energy storage is prohibited in specific markets due to safety concerns, regulatory gaps, or infrastructure limitations. While energy storage systems (ESS) are critical for renewable energy integration, regional policies often dictate where and how they can operate. This article explores the reasons behind these restrictions and offers practical alternatives for industries affected by such bans.
Key Reasons Behind Prohibition Policies
- Safety Risks: Thermal runaway incidents in lithium-ion batteries have led to fire safety regulations.
- Grid Compatibility: Aging power infrastructures struggle to handle bidirectional energy flows.
- Environmental Concerns: Recycling challenges for battery components in developing economies.
- Policy Lag: Regulations haven't caught up with rapid ESS technological advancements.

Industry-Specific Solutions
Where battery energy storage is prohibited, these alternatives are gaining traction:
1. Hydrogen Energy Storage Systems
PEM electrolyzers coupled with fuel cells now achieve 58% round-trip efficiency, becoming viable for industrial applications.
2. Flywheel Technology
Kinetic energy storage provides 15-second response times for grid frequency regulation – 3x faster than traditional batteries.
3. Compressed Air ESS
New adiabatic CAES systems reach 70% efficiency, suitable for large-scale renewable integration.

FAQ
Why are some areas banning battery storage?
Primary concerns include fire risks, grid instability, and environmental protection requirements.
What's the most cost-effective alternative to batteries?
Thermal storage systems currently offer the lowest $/kWh for large-scale applications.
How long do these restrictions typically last?
Most regions revise policies within 3-5 years as safety standards and technologies evolve.
Can existing battery systems be modified for compliance?
In some cases, adding fire suppression systems or capacity limits may permit continued operation.
